Product Overview
An iron-based gear specification must define the required powder or steel material system and final properties, not just the general metal family.
Tooth and mounting data remain essential.
Structure & Mating Interfaces
Provide the full gear geometry, mating arrangement and load conditions.
State the material specification or the property requirements used for route selection.
Engineering Focus
Why specify more than a broad iron-based material description?
The material family does not identify a single composition or delivered condition.
A clear specification is needed to compare production routes and inspect the resulting part.
This prevents different technical proposals from being treated as equivalent on name alone.
Manufacturing Route & Finishing
Compare PM and other gear-production methods for the actual section and volume.
Density or heat-treatment requirements, where applicable, must be agreed with the selected process.
The proposed route is confirmed for your drawing, material and quantity. An image does not establish a fixed tolerance or a complete process specification.

Define material and final treatment against load direction, wear and the operating environment.
Mark surfaces whose fit or contact changes after finishing.
Rated loads, pressure limits and operating life require their own agreed design and acceptance requirements.

Inspect teeth, bore and face relationships along with the specified material evidence.
Verify the agreed gear or assembly acceptance requirements.
Specify the drawing revision and the condition in which each dimension is inspected. Record the agreed dimensional and functional checks before sample approval.

- Component definition. Send the 2D drawing and 3D model, where available, with the drawing revision and the requested part or assembly scope.
- Mating information. Include the assembly references needed to define the interfaces discussed above.
- Delivered condition. State material, finishing and inspection requirements, identifying any items that need a manufacturing recommendation.
- Supply plan. Include sample needs, expected order and annual quantities, packaging requirements and target timing.
